Duarte Benavente won the 2020 UIM F2 World Championship in Vila Velha de Ródão this afternoon in convincing style. The Portuguese driver won from pole position and looked absolutely dominant in his Mercury powered Moore hull. Sami Seliö broke the Vila Velha de Ródão course record during the 45 minute warm-up session this morning. Seliö carded the 40.4233 time and sent a signal that he will be strong contender this afternoon. Duarte Benavente posted a 40.543 early in the session, at the the time it looked unbeatable! The 2020 UIM F2 World Championship will be decided in Vila Velha de Ródão, Portugal on Sunday. Duarte Benavente tops the points table with 35 points with Edgaras Riabko on 27 and Owen Jelf with 22. Britain’s Owen Jelf took a lights to flag win in Portugal this afternoon. Run in gusty conditions, the race was yellow flagged on lap 30 when Jelf’s brother Colin crashed out of contention.
